1. Micro Interactions
In modern web design, interactions play a pivotal role in driving user engagement.
Today’s users crave dynamic, immersive web experiences, and interactions fulfill this demand.
When a webpage comes alive with interactive elements, it draws users in, making them feel an active part of the digital landscape.
But you must proceed with prudence in your endeavor. Although interactions can give a design life, they must be carefully planned and implemented. Therefore, as designers, we must tread carefully to ensure that interactions enhance rather than detract from the user experience, resulting in a seamless and engrossing digital trip.
